Every month these projections change because new price data comes in that helps us refine our projections. With more data, we can check which past years in the market looked most like the current trading activity and we can then incorporate that into more current forecasts. This is why we publish a monthly newsletter with new forecasts every month instead of one static forecast for the entire year, which doesn't work.
